Transaction f210da6c59b96eeb6682e1525e470be5d0eed43d132cf6a8f94d6c6e52ff85ee

block
967900050f813553b6f0a5f1513da1eeef88fc26cd60507522b5c1cfe0a81d50

1 Input

23 Outputs